reasoned |
||
| 1. | [ adjective ] reflects weight of sound argument or evidence | |
| Synonyms: | well-grounded sound | |
| Examples: | "a sound argument" |

| 3. | [ adjective ] resulting from careful thought | |
| Synonyms: | considered well_thought_out | |
| Examples: | "the paper was well thought out" |
